THE ENVIRONMENT
Marmocil uses a cutting technology without the use of chemical
products. Water is used, which is fully reused after treatment.
For such reuse, the company uses a system of separating the
stone dust from the water in the cutting and polishing processes.
The dust, after it is separated by decanting and pressing,
has as its final destination a sanitary earthwork, following
all the environmental legislation rules. As for the water,
after the filtering process, returns clean to be used in the
productive process.
RELATIONSHIP WITH THE COMMUNITY
Environmental education program
With the purpose of fulfilling its social function, Marmocil
invests on research, education, and environmental improvement.
Currently, an environmental education program is beginning
to be implanted and involves three schools in the company
headquarters neighborhood.
The project provides for teachers qualification and the distribution
of didactic materials focusing on themes chosen by the schools
themselves. Other goals are the implantation of a small greenhouse
for seedlings at each school in the project and the revitalization
of the free areas in such schools and in the district.
Reinforcing its internal commitment to the environmental
issues, the company also keeps an environmental education
program with all its staff and third-party technical team.
They participate in the selective collection of waste throughout
the company’s industrial and administrative unit, separating
the waste and donating that which can be recycled to recycling
associations and cooperative units.
Social program
The recyclable waste selected at the company by selective
collection is donated to ASCAVIVE – The Vila Velha Waste-Pickers
Association.
ASCAVIVE currently has 18 members, former street-dwellers,
who participate of all the process stages, taking turns between
the external work (of waste collection in residences and stores)
and the internal work, at their headquarters, where the waste
is selected, weighed, pressed, and stored until its commercialization.
